FORT WORTH – The Texas A&M men's tennis team opened with a successful day at the ITA Sectional Championships at the Bayard H. Friedman Tennis Center on Thursday.
Â
Sophomore Tiago Pires took home the best win of his career over William Jansen of Ohio State, 6-4, 6-4.
Â
Senior JC Roddick advances after a two-set victory over Michael Kouame of Memphis, 6-4, 6-1.
Â
Fellow senior Giulio Perego claimed the match after a three-set challenge against Bruno Nhavene of Oklahoma, 7-6 (1), 3-6, 7-5.
Â
Junior Togan Tokac fell in his opening match against Jack Anthrop of Ohio State, 6-4, 2-6, 6-0. He moves to compete in the consolation round of 16.
Â
The doubles duo of Perego and Tokac advanced to the quarterfinals with a win over Calvin Mueller/Anton Shepp of Nebraska, 7-6 (9), 7-6 (10).
Â
Play continues tomorrow with the doubles quarterfinals and singles round of 16.
